[发明专利]基于Sharding-Proxy的容器化方法及装置在审
申请号: | 202210065406.2 | 申请日: | 2022-01-20 |
公开(公告)号: | CN114416300A | 公开(公告)日: | 2022-04-29 |
发明(设计)人: | 任昊文;敖知琪;陈禹旭;崔焱;代昊琦;康旖;梁子健;刘明伟 | 申请(专利权)人: | 南方电网数字电网研究院有限公司 |
主分类号: | G06F9/455 | 分类号: | G06F9/455;G06F9/445;G06F9/448;G06F9/50 |
代理公司: | 北京润泽恒知识产权代理有限公司 11319 | 代理人: | 苟冬梅 |
地址: | 510000 广东省广州市黄*** | 国省代码: | 广东;44 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 基于 sharding proxy 容器 方法 装置 | ||
1.基于Sharding-Proxy的容器化方法,其特征在于,所述方法包括:
管理平台获取所述Sharding-Proxy集群的镜像,并基于所述镜像配置Sharding-Proxy集群的资源;所述资源包括集群最大资源配额、所述集群内部节点数量、每个所述节点内部的CPU分配、每个所述节点内部的内存分配和每个所述节点内部的磁盘分配;
所述管理平台创建Sharding-Proxy集群实例;并基于配置的所述Sharding-Proxy集群镜像的资源,对所述Sharding-Proxy集群实例进行初始化,以启动所述Sharding-Proxy集群实例;
在所述Sharding-Proxy集群实例运行时,所述管理平台对所述Sharding-Proxy集群实例进行监控和维护;
响应于对所述Sharding-Proxy集群实例的终止请求,管理平台停止Sharding-Proxy集群实例的运行并删除所述Sharding-Proxy集群实例,以释放为所述Sharding-Proxy集群配置的资源。
2.根据权利要求1所述的一种方法,其特征在于,所述管理平台获取所述Sharding-Proxy集群的镜像,并基于所述镜像配置Sharding-Proxy集群的资源,包括:
所述管理平台获取所述Sharding-Proxy集群的下载接口,并基于所述下载接口下载所述Sharding-Proxy集群,创建所述Sharding-Proxy集群的镜像;
所述管理平台获取所述Sharding-Proxy集群实例的资源配额,所述资源配额包括所述Sharding-Proxy集群实例的节点个数、每个所述节点的CPU、每个节点的内存大小和每个节点的磁盘大小;
所述管理平台基于所述Sharding-Proxy集群实例的资源配额,配置所述Sharding-Proxy集群的资源。
3.根据权利要求2所述的一种方法,其特征在于,所述管理平台创建Sharding-Proxy集群实例;并基于配置的所述Sharding-Proxy集群镜像的资源,对所述Sharding-Proxy集群实例进行初始化,以启动所述Sharding-Proxy集群实例,包括:
所述管理平台获取所述Sharding-Proxy集群实例中每个节点的第一数据源接口;
所述管理平台创建Sharding-Proxy集群实例,并将所述第一数据源接口与所述Sharding-Proxy集群实例中的各个节点连接。
4.根据权利要求1所述的一种方法,其特征在于,所述在所述Sharding-Proxy集群实例运行时,所述管理平台对所述Sharding-Proxy集群实例进行监控和维护,包括:
所述管理平台切换所述Sharding-Proxy集群实例的数据源配置;
所述管理平台对Sharding-Proxy集群实例的内部节点进行熔断处理;
所述管理平台更新所述Sharding-Proxy集群实例的内部节点的配置信息,所述配置信息用于指示所述内部节点所连接的数据源;
所述管理平台对所述Sharding-Proxy集群实例的内部节点进行增加与删除;
所述监控组件对所述Sharding-Proxy集群实例的资源使用进行监控。
5.根据权利要求4所述的一种方法,其特征在于,所述管理平台切换所述Sharding-Proxy集群实例的数据源配置,包括:
所述管理平台获取所述Sharding-Proxy集群实例的中每个节点的第二数据源接口;
所述管理平台将所述第二数据源接口与所述Sharding-Proxy集群实例中的各个节点连接。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于南方电网数字电网研究院有限公司,未经南方电网数字电网研究院有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/202210065406.2/1.html,转载请声明来源钻瓜专利网。